61505100015 has 16 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 98874554496. Its totient is φ = 32647255200.
The previous prime is 61505100011. The next prime is 61505100091. The reversal of 61505100015 is 51000150516.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 61505100015 - 22 = 61505100011 is a prime.
It is a congruent number.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(61505100011)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(23)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 15 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 9713281 + ... + 9719610.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(6179659656).
Almost surely, 261505100015 is an apocalyptic number.
61505100015 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(37369454481).
61505100015 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
61505100015 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 19433110.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 750, while the sum is 24.
The spelling of 61505100015 in words is "sixty-one billion, five hundred five million, one hundred thousand, fifteen".
